 Sunrisers Hyderabad Seal Final Berth with Commanding Win Over Rajasthan Royals

 

Sunrisers Hyderabad booked their place in the IPL 2024 final with a convincing 36-run victory over Rajasthan Royals in Qualifier 2 at the MA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ai.

 

Put in to bat first, SRH posted a competitive 175/9 on the board. The Royals' chase faltered in the absence of significant dew, with the SRH spinners, Abhishek Sharma and Shahbaz Ahmed, running riot, claiming a combined five wickets to dismantle the Rajasthan top order.

 

SRH Bat First and Set a Target of 176

 

Despite losing wickets at regular intervals, the Sunrisers managed a decent total. Key contributions came from middle-order batsmen Rahul Tripathi (38) and Abhishek Sharma (27), who steadied the innings after a shaky start. In the death overs, some quick cameos from Nicholas Pooran (24) and Jason Holder (22) propelled SRH to a fighting score.

 

Rajasthan's Chase Crumbles Against SRH Spinners

 

The Royals' hopes for a comfortable chase were dashed by the lack of dew and some excellent bowling from the SRH spinners. Openers Jos Buttler and Yashasvi Jaiswal fell cheaply, and the middle order, apart from a fighting knock from Sanju Samson (42), failed to capitalize.

 

Abhishek Sharma and Shahbaz Ahmed spun a web around the Rajasthan batsmen, taking crucial wickets at regular intervals. Jofra Archer provided some late resistance with a 20-ball 32, but it was too little, too late for the Royals.

 

Sunrisers Hyderabad to Face Kolkata Knight Riders in the Final

 

With this win, the Sunrisers Hyderabad have reached their third IPL final. They will now lock horns with the Kolkata Knight Riders in a mouthwatering summit clash at the same venue on Sunday. The stage is set for an exciting finale to the IPL 2024 season!
